In deeper waters, manta rays have often been seen diving to depths of around 2,000 feet, but have been known to go much deeper on occasions, with their powerful wings propelling them through the water. Ecuador currently has the largest individual population of manta rays with around 650 having been identified there. Reef manta rays are mainly found in the Indo-Pacific ocean while the giant manta rays frequent the seas all the way around the equator. Manta rays are usually found in tropical and subtropical waters and are migratory animals that largely follow where the food is. In fact, manta rays are actually extremely gentle and friendly creatures that are not harmful at all. Although these huge rays are often mistaken for stingrays, they don’t have a barb on their tail and so can’t sting. Both species have the typical manta ray coloring of black on their back and white on their bellies but giant manta rays have black mouths while reef manta rays have white mouths. The giant manta ray is the larger of the two. The Background on Manta RaysĪs well as their distinctive shape and massive wings, manta rays can easily be distinguished by their wide mouths and “horns” that are actually called cephalic fins or lobes and are used for channeling water and food into their mouths while they are feeding. Also known as birds of the sea, these huge fish have an average wingspan of 23 feet and a weight of about 4,500 pounds.
